Markdown Preview for (Neo)vim 常见问题解决方案
项目基础介绍
Markdown Preview for (Neo)vim 是一个用于在 (Neo)vim 中预览 Markdown 文件的插件。它支持在现代浏览器中实时预览 Markdown 文件,并提供同步滚动和灵活的配置选项。该项目主要使用 VimScript 和 JavaScript 编写,依赖于 Node.js 和 Yarn 进行构建和运行。
新手使用注意事项及解决方案
1. 安装 Node.js 和 Yarn
问题描述:项目依赖于 Node.js 和 Yarn,如果没有安装这些工具,插件将无法正常工作。
解决步骤:
-
安装 Node.js:
- 访问 Node.js 官网 下载并安装最新版本的 Node.js。
- 安装完成后,通过命令行运行
node -v
确认安装成功。
-
安装 Yarn:
- 在命令行中运行
npm install -g yarn
安装 Yarn。 - 安装完成后,通过命令行运行
yarn -v
确认安装成功。
- 在命令行中运行
2. 插件安装失败
问题描述:在安装插件时,可能会遇到安装失败的情况,通常是由于网络问题或依赖包未正确安装。
解决步骤:
-
检查网络连接:
- 确保你的网络连接正常,能够访问 GitHub 和 npm 仓库。
-
手动安装依赖:
- 打开终端,进入插件目录(通常在
~/.vim/plugged/markdown-preview.nvim/app
)。 - 运行
yarn install
手动安装依赖包。
- 打开终端,进入插件目录(通常在
-
重新安装插件:
- 在 Vim 或 Neovim 中运行
:PlugInstall
或:PackerInstall
重新安装插件。
- 在 Vim 或 Neovim 中运行
3. 预览窗口无法打开
问题描述:安装完成后,预览窗口无法正常打开,可能是由于配置问题或浏览器设置不当。
解决步骤:
-
检查配置文件:
- 确保你的
.vimrc
或init.vim
文件中正确配置了插件。例如:Plug 'iamcco/markdown-preview.nvim', { 'do': 'cd app && yarn install' }
- 确保你的
-
设置浏览器:
- 默认情况下,插件会使用系统默认浏览器打开预览窗口。如果需要指定浏览器,可以在配置文件中设置:
let g:mkdp_browser = 'firefox' " 例如指定使用 Firefox
- 默认情况下,插件会使用系统默认浏览器打开预览窗口。如果需要指定浏览器,可以在配置文件中设置:
-
手动打开预览:
- 在 Vim 或 Neovim 中打开 Markdown 文件后,运行
:MarkdownPreview
手动打开预览窗口。
- 在 Vim 或 Neovim 中打开 Markdown 文件后,运行
通过以上步骤,新手用户可以顺利解决在使用 Markdown Preview for (Neo)vim 插件时遇到的一些常见问题。